Industry sector of employment

More Benalla Rural City residents worked in health care and social assistance than any other industry in 2021.

Benalla Rural City's industry statistics identify the industry sectors in which the residents work (which may be within the residing area or elsewhere). This will be influenced by the skill base and socio-economic status of the residents as well as the industries and employment opportunities present in the region.

When viewed in conjunction with Residents Place of Work data and Method of Travel to Work, industry sector statistics provide insights into the relationship between the economic and residential role of the area.

Dominant groups

An analysis of the jobs held by the resident population in Benalla Rural City in 2021 shows the three most popular industry sectors were:

  • Health Care and Social Assistance (946 people or 15.1%)
  • Construction (786 people or 12.6%)
  •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ing (604 people or 9.7%)

In combination, these three industries employed 2,336 people in total or 37.4% of the total employed resident population.

In comparison, Regional VIC employed 16.2% in Health Care and Social Assistance; 10.0% in Construction; and 7.2% in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ing.

The major differences between the jobs held by the population of Benalla Rural City and Regional VIC were:

  • A larger percentage of persons employed in construction (12.6% compared to 10.0%)
  • A larger percentage of persons employed in agriculture, forestry and fishing (9.7% compared to 7.2%)
  • A larger percentage of persons employed in manufacturing (8.5% compared to 7.4%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ons employed in retail trade (8.2% compared to 9.5%)

Emerging groups

The number of employed people in Benalla Rural City increased by 600 between 2016 and 2021.

The largest changes in the jobs held by the resident population between 2016 and 2021 in Benalla Rural City were for those employed in:

  • Construction (+310 persons)
  • Health Care and Social Assistance (+133 persons)
  • Public Administration and Safety (+71 persons)
  • Wholesale trade (-62 persons)
